Andreas Vernersson wrote:
> 
> One day ago i posted a simple question about the 4byte large ints
> 32-bits compiler have.. and i got  11 answers, all of them saying
> mostly exactly the same things.. I think this is very annoying
> and unnecessary, couldn't you guys read what other people have
> answered before you post the same things?

It is quite possible that when each of those eleven people responded,
they couldn't see each others posts.  Apparently, news propogates
relatively slowly.  For example, my server *still* shows only two
responses to your first post (one from "The Lost Wizard of Nothing",
and one from Fred Smith).  It currently shows NO replies to your
complaint.

Furthermore, I have seen plenty of replies in newsgroups which are
completely wrong, so eleven identical reponses should provide some
level of confidence in the answer to your question.
